After their first two games, Kane Williamson's side are at the top of the standings over Australia on net run rate after achieving two contrasting victories. They cruised to a 10-wicket win over Sri Lanka in their opening game, then lurched to a two-wicket victory against Bangladesh on Wednesday at The Oval in London.
